Balsamic Meats: A Sensory Journey

Why not explore new possibilities by using balsamic vinegar in innovative ways? Try marinating meat before cooking: its ability to penetrate the fibers makes every bite tender and flavorful.

Perfect Meat Marinade

Ingredients: Chicken breast or beef filet, extra virgin olive oil, fresh minced garlic, fresh rosemary, and balsamic vinegar.

Balsamic tip: De Nigris Balsamic Vinegar of Modena PGI Aquila Oro is perfect for this preparation. Its bold, velvety flavor and enveloping density seep into the meat, adding a smooth sweet-and-tangy touch.

A Sweet-and-Sour Touch for Dessert

Balsamic vinegar is also a surprising ally in desserts, adding sophistication and originality to the end of a meal. Often reserved for savory dishes, it can also shine in sweet preparations, delighting with its unique aromatic profile.

Fresh Fruit with Balsamic

Ingredients: Juicy grilled peaches or pineapple slices—or, as an alternative, ripe strawberries, lemon zest, and fresh mint.

Balsamic tip: Add a few drops of De Nigris Balsamic Vinegar of Modena PGI “Founder’s Recipe”. Its sweet-and-sour notes pair beautifully with the natural sugars of the fruit.
